MU is determined to buy Baleba.
Following the Grimsby Town disaster in the 2025/26 League Cup, Manchester United officials decided to resume negotiations to buy midfielder Carlos Baleba.

Manchester United viewed Baleba as a priority to strengthen their midfield, but previous discussions with Brighton failed to reach an agreement.
Brighton's asking price of £100 million is unrealistic. Manchester United will try to negotiate to bring the price of the Cameroonian midfielder down to the lowest possible level.
According to MEN , Manchester United have a chance to sign Baleba when the English football transfer window closes on September 1st. The "Red Devils" could influence the 21-year-old to request a departure.
Milan negotiates for Nkunku.
In an effort to strengthen their squad before the summer transfer window closes, AC Milan are rushing to finalize the signing of Christopher Nkunku.

Negotiations between Milan and Chelsea are progressing well. The Rossoneri are willing to pay for Nkunku as requested by the 2025 FIFA Club World Cup champions.
Chelsea needs to sell Nkunku and several other players to make way for Alejandro Garnacho and Xavi Simons, avoiding potential problems with Sustainable Profits regulations.
Nkunku himself expressed his desire to move to Milan after carefully considering various options from across Europe.
Newcastle want Gallagher
According to Spanish media reports, after Crystal Palace, Newcastle has also officially expressed interest in bringing Conor Gallagher back to English football .

Newcastle currently have only 1 point after 2 Premier League matches in the 2025/26 season, despite playing well. Manager Eddie Howe wants to bring in more players to strengthen the midfield.
Gallagher stands out for his fighting spirit, willingness to engage in physical challenges, and excellent passing ability. However, he is not a good fit for Atletico Madrid.
Diego Simeone has opened the door for Gallagher to leave. Now, Newcastle needs to convince Atletico with a higher price than Crystal Palace.
